Q:How can I ship a large piece of furniture?
LTL freight shipping LTL stands for "less than truckload." LTL furniture shipping is a cost-effective way to ship freight items that don't require a full truckload. It's suitable for transporting furniture that is too large for parcel carriers like UPS and FedEx but doesn't require the space of a full truck.
Q:What is the cheapest way to ship furniture internationally?
Ocean freight shipping Ocean shipping is a great option for bulkier shipments since it offers much more space than air for a lower price. Depending on how large your shipments are, and how frequently you ship, you can choose either LCL (less than a container load) or FCL (full container load).

Q:How long does mail take from CA to NY?
Mail from California to New York generally takes 3 to 5 days for standard First-Class Mail, but can range from 1-3 days with Priority Mail or faster services, to potentially longer for cheaper options like Media Mail (2-8 days). The exact time depends on the specific USPS service (First-Class, Priority, Express) and the shipping day, with coast-to-coast typically falling in the 3-5 day window for standard mail.

Q:What is the average cost to move a piano?
Moving a piano costs about $400 on average. However, costs vary depending on several factors, such as cost per mile (the starting price is about $50), the type of piano (a grand piano is typically high-priced), height and weight, ease of access, and the need for disassembly and reassembly.
Q:How to ship a piano out of state?
To ship a piano to another state, hire professional long-distance piano movers for specialized handling, as DIY is risky; they'll typically use custom crating, moving blankets, and climate-controlled trucks, costing $450 to over $2,000+ depending on distance, piano type, and service level, with options for White Glove service or fitting into portable containers like PODS. Key steps involve choosing a specialized mover, getting insurance, crating/blanketing the piano, and arranging for secure transport and delivery.

Q:What is a full service move?
A full-service move is one where professional movers load the truck with all your belongings and transport them to your new residence, where they unload the truck. They can also help with packing and unpacking if you choose the added service.

Q:How do I ship one piece of furniture to another state?
To ship a single piece of furniture across long distances, choose a parcel carrier like UPS or USPS for small items. For larger pieces, such as beds or sofas, consider a freight service offering LTL (Less Than Truckload) shipping—it's cost-effective, and your furniture will be transported with other loads.
Q:How to ship a bed frame?
Wrap wood frames in a blanket or bubble wrap. Do not place packing tape on the wood to prevent damage. Box all small wood parts after wrapping in a protective layer. Cover the bed frame with a blanket or packaging as well to prevent scratching. We recommend extra covering, such as cardboard (a cardboard box is best).
